When Lead and Oxygen combine to form PbO and PbO2, then the ratio of Oxygen combining with a fixed weight of Lead is :Select an answerA1 : 2B2 : 1C1 : 1DNone of these
Solution
The answer to this question is A1 : 2.
Here's the step by step explanation:
-
When Lead (Pb) combines with Oxygen (O), it forms two compounds: PbO and PbO2.
-
In PbO, the ratio of Pb to O is 1:1. This means for every one atom of Pb, one atom of O is required.
-
In PbO2, the ratio of Pb to O is 1:2. This means for every one atom of Pb, two atoms of O are required.
-
Therefore, when comparing the amount of Oxygen that combines with a fixed weight of Lead in both compounds, the ratio is 1:2.
